Output e89583e3ebf887c068ed996df0bb90c611677b94d5e379acf6b6c057dfaa2214:52

value
682670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9169ad49fc20b58974b640e98f87720e6e1130b3 OP_EQUAL
address
3EwtVvHp1hgPGuLQqtqHRmKnw5H5DFRhdH
transaction
e89583e3ebf887c068ed996df0bb90c611677b94d5e379acf6b6c057dfaa2214